У нас вы можете посмотреть бесплатно Why Senior Developers Use Maps Instead of Objects или скачать в максимальном доступном качестве, видео которое было загружено на ютуб. Для загрузки выберите вариант из формы ниже:
Если кнопки скачивания не
загрузились
Н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если возникают проблемы со скачиванием видео, пожалуйста напишите в поддержку по адресу внизу
страницы.
Спасибо за использование сервиса ClipSaver.ru
We all love JavaScript Objects. They are the building blocks of the language. But if you are using them as dictionaries or hash maps to store dynamic data, you are likely hurting your code's performance and safety. In this video, we break down the JavaScript Map data structure. We explore why it was introduced in ES6, how it solves the infamous "Object Key Collision" bug, and why its performance for frequent additions and removals destroys plain Objects. We also cover the specific use cases where you should stick with Objects, and when you should upgrade to a Map. In this video, you will learn: Why Objects convert all keys to strings (and why that's bad). How to use Objects and DOM elements as keys in a Map. The performance difference: .size vs Object.keys().length. Guaranteed iteration order. The ultimate rule of thumb: Map vs Object.